What Is Supply Chain Visibility, and Why It Matters
Definition and Core Elements
Supply chain visibility means having a clear, real‑time picture of products, information, and finances as they move through every stage of the supply chain.
Key elements include shipment tracking, inventory monitoring, demand forecasting, and collaboration tools that connect buyers, suppliers, and logistics partners.
Benefits for Modern Businesses
High visibility reduces stockouts, improves customer satisfaction, and enables proactive risk management.
Companies that invest in visibility tools report average inventory reductions of 15‑20% and lead‑time improvements of up to 30%.
Common Pain Points
- Fragmented data across silos.
- Delayed alerts on shipment delays.
- Limited analytics and reporting.
- Complex integration with legacy systems.
Addressing these issues is where the best supply chain visibility software shines.

Key Features That Differentiate the Best Software
When evaluating these tools, keep an eye on the following features that consistently set the best packages apart.
Real‑Time Tracking and Alerts
Instant notifications for delays, customs holds, or route changes.
Increases responsiveness and reduces downstream impact.
AI‑Powered Forecasting
Predictive analytics help align supply with demand.
Reduces overstock and stockouts.
Seamless Integration
APIs, connectors, and native integrations with ERP, WMS, and TMS.
Minimizes data silos and manual entry.
User‑Friendly Dashboards
Customizable views that highlight KPIs.
Facilitates quick decision making.
Scalability and Cloud Deployment
Auto‑scaling to handle peak demand spikes.
Cloud reduces on‑prem overhead and speeds up rollout.
Security and Compliance
GDPR, SOC2, ISO 27001 certifications.
Protects sensitive supply chain data.

Expert Tips for Implementing Visibility Software
- Define clear KPIs before selecting a platform.
- Start with a pilot project covering one product line.
- Leverage existing data warehouses for richer analytics.
- Use APIs to connect suppliers and carriers early.
- Invest in training to maximize user adoption.
- Schedule quarterly reviews to refine data feeds.
- Set up automated alerts for critical events.
- Monitor data latency and optimize network connections.
